Output f596123caddeb581700274ee0c0156b11d802d33a5b21fd8f924fcc1141e400a:0

value
2443836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ea4c8d3c3f10d62b3a2a8433090a3656194aef OP_EQUAL
address
3CMCzBHLzoD7Y6AdbTKZ48gDLyEm6CUuEx
transaction
f596123caddeb581700274ee0c0156b11d802d33a5b21fd8f924fcc1141e400a
confirmations
293047
spent
true